An evaluation by Promise Hospital is a good suggestion. They are very good treating people in similar condition as your dad and then transferring them to a rehab facility when they are stable. Make sure the case manager at the hospital check with each center to see what insurances they take; this will make a difference where your dad can be referred to. The Club, for instance, only takes Medicare - no managed care plans, i.e., United, Freedom. Humana, Care Plus. Also, if you can, pay a visit to each facility and take a tour. Good luck!
